Real Simple reports that tapestries are enjoying a resurgence in 2026 as a centuries-old decor trend being embraced for their texture, historical depth and storytelling qualities. The article explains that designers and homeowners are integrating both antique and modern woven textiles as oversized wall art, layered with other materials, or adapted into furniture and accessories to add richness, warmth and visual interest to contemporary interiors.
